- Skills Covered / Tools Used
- ISO 17025 Clause Interpretation: Master the precise meaning and practical application of each requirement, spanning general, structural, resource, process, and management system clauses.
- Risk-Based Thinking Application: Learn to effectively identify, analyze, and mitigate risks and opportunities within laboratory processes to enhance reliability and informed decision-making.
- Measurement Uncertainty Estimation: Develop proficiency in estimating, evaluating, and reporting measurement uncertainty, a cornerstone of metrological traceability and valid test results.
- Method Validation & Verification: Understand the comprehensive principles and practical steps for validating new methods and verifying established ones to assure fitness for purpose.
- Internal Audit Proficiency: Gain hands-on skills in planning, conducting, reporting, and effectively following up on internal audits, crucial for assessing QMS effectiveness.
- Corrective Action Formulation: Learn to formulate effective corrective actions, including robust root cause analysis, to address nonconformities and prevent systematic recurrence.
- Proficiency Testing Understanding: Comprehend the critical importance of interlaboratory comparisons and proficiency testing as powerful tools for demonstrating and maintaining laboratory competence.
- Effective Document Control: Design and manage robust documentation systems for policies, procedures, work instructions, and records, ensuring data integrity and accessibility.
- Equipment Management Strategies: Implement comprehensive protocols for the calibration, maintenance, and intermediate checks of equipment to assure ongoing accuracy and reliability.
- Clear Results Reporting: Master the essential elements for clear, unambiguous, and accurate reporting of test and calibration results to clients, meeting all standard requirements.
- Management Review Execution: Understand how to effectively plan and conduct management reviews to ensure the continuing suitability, adequacy, and effectiveness of the QMS.
- Complaint Handling Procedures: Develop systematic and impartial approaches for receiving, evaluating, and making decisions on complaints from clients or other parties.
- Nonconforming Work Management: Learn to identify, control, evaluate, and process nonconforming testing or calibration work, including impact assessment.
- Metrological Traceability Establishment: Ensure an unbroken chain of comparisons relating measurement results to national or international standards.
